    Nikolai Valuev on the Haye fight...

    By Alexey Potapov....






    WBA heavyweight champion Nikolai Valuev has given an exclusive interview to *********.com in which he speaks about his upcoming fight against former WBC/WBA/WBO cruiserweight champion David Haye on November 7th in Germany. It had been previously announced that Haye would fight against WBC heavyweight champion Vitali Klitschko on September 12, but the British hope then decided to challenge for Valuev’s title instead.
    Hello, Niko! I am glad to see you again!

    Hi, Alex! *********.com best regards!

    Niko, news about your fight with Haye has left many shocked. How quickly did you make a decision to take this fight?

    Negotiations were conducted very quickly. It didn’t take long for me to think about and agree to this fight. I am sure that I’m better than him.

    You knew that Haye would pull out of the fight with Vitali Klitschko?

    Yes, I knew about it, but Vitali has not followed through on his promises. Several months ago Vitali and I spoke by phone and agreed to have a fight between us. Then Vitali stopped speaking to me. I communicated this to my promoter and they informed me that Klitschko doesn’t wish to fight me. What should I do after that? Wait? But by the time of this fight I’ll have not fought for nearly a year. A strong contender is necessary for me. I have chosen Haye. Unlike Team Klitschko, we have quickly come to an agreement with him.

    Now having selected Vitali’s planned opponent, do you think this could cost you a fight against the Klitschkos?

    If the Klitschko brothers wish to claim all the titles, they should fight me.

    Haye hasn’t always proved to be a gentleman. You know about his t-shirt depicting the chopped-off heads of the Klitschko brothers. Are you ready for such treatment?

    I think that will only make it worse for Haye! He will not distract me from my psychological balance. I have immunity to such things. And if he does manage to provoke me, he will be held responsible in the ring!

    Why have you have chosen Haye? He’s not the official challenger on your title.

    It’s my voluntary defense and I can fight with whomever I want.

    The WBA’s mandatory challenger John Ruiz is protesting the fight and demanding through his lawyers that the WBA not authorize a fight between you and Haye.

    Who is John Ruiz? To me it’s scandalous that he lives all his life in court in front of a judge. I’ve already beat him two times. I’m much stronger than him. He is not interesting to me as a challenger!

    What about the fact that Haye has had only one fight in the division since officially moving to heavyweight?

    He was the world champion at cruiserweight. He is very fast and dangerous, but I know that I’ll win. I’ll look at his fights, I’ll study him. I know he likes to talk for long amounts of time, but I will make the fight short.

    Haye has stated that he refused the fight against Klitschko because of a bad contract. What conditions did Haye demand?

    I don’t know. Ask my promoter. But I think it wasn’t the money. I know that Klitschko offered bad conditions for Haye. I even looked at the contract. These conditions were awful! The Klitschko brothers think only of their own benefit when make contracts for their opponents.

    When you will begin preparation for fight?

    For two weeks I’ve been preparing for the fight. Now I’m preparing in Russia, then I’ll have my main camp in Germany.

    Are you afraid that Haye will pull out of the fight as he did with the Klitschko brothers?

    No. After dealing with Ruslan Chagaev, now I’m not afraid of anything.
